OSDN Git Service

陸戦航空戦での進撃前大破チェックを可能にした
authormasakih <masakih@users.sourceforge.jp>
Thu, 11 Feb 2016 08:19:17 +0000 (17:19 +0900)
committermasakih <masakih@users.sourceforge.jp>
Thu, 11 Feb 2016 08:19:17 +0000 (17:19 +0900)
KCD/HMAirBattleCommand.m
KCD/HMCalculateDamageCommand.m

index f8d95f2..5b06285 100644 (file)
 
 + (BOOL)canExcuteAPI:(NSString *)api
 {
-       return [api isEqualToString:@"/kcsapi/api_req_sortie/airbattle"];
+       if([api isEqualToString:@"/kcsapi/api_req_sortie/airbattle"]) return YES;
+       if([api isEqualToString:@"/kcsapi/api_req_sortie/ld_airbattle"]) return YES;
+       
+       return NO;
 }
 
 - (id)init
index 83dbd0e..1667503 100644 (file)
@@ -475,6 +475,10 @@ NSInteger damageControlIfPossible(NSInteger nowhp, HMKCShipObject *ship)
                [self calculateMidnightBattle];
                return;
        }
+       if([self.api isEqualToString:@"/kcsapi/api_req_sortie/ld_airbattle"]) {
+               [self calculateBattle];
+               return;
+       }
        
        /*
         /kcsapi/api_req_combined_battle/battle_water